Air Algérie Orders 10 Boeing 737-8s as Fleet Renewal Accelerates

Summary by aerotime.aero
Air Algérie has ordered 10 Boeing 737 MAX 8 aircraft, with deliveries set to begin in summer 2026 as the Algerian flag carrier continues its fleet renewal.  The airline said five of the jets will arrive in 2026 starting in July, with the other five due in 2027.  The order gives Air Algérie a newer-generation narrowbody as it begins replacing and supplementing a short- and medium-haul fleet centered on older Boeing 737NGs. The national airline Air Algeria has announced the acquisition of 10 Boeing 737 MAX-8, marking a new stage in the modernization of its medium-haul fleet. This order comes in a context of increased competition in the Maghreb, where Algeria intends not to let its Moroccan neighbour dominate the sky of the region.
